Today’s blog is more for my brethren here in the United States. The Holy Spirit through scripture reminds us:

We are commanded not to oppress the alien / foreigner / sojourner:

  • Jeremiah 7:6 NASB – 6 [if] you do not oppress the alien, the orphan, or the widow, and do not shed innocent blood in this place, nor walk after other gods to your own ruin,
  • Ezekiel 22:7-8 NASB – 7 “They have treated father and mother lightly within you. The alien they have oppressed in your midst; the fatherless and the widow they have wronged in you. 8 “You have despised My holy things and profaned My sabbaths.
  • Malachi 3:5 NASB – 5 “Then I will draw near to you for judgment; and I will be a swift witness against the sorcerers and against the adulterers and against those who swear falsely, and against those who oppress the wage earner in his wages, the widow and the orphan, and those who turn aside the alien and do not fear Me,” says the LORD of hosts.

Because as the household of faith we were:

  • Acts 7:6 NASB – 6 “But God spoke to this effect, that his DESCENDANTS WOULD BE ALIENS IN A FOREIGN LAND, AND THAT THEY WOULD BE ENSLAVED AND MISTREATED FOR FOUR HUNDRED YEARS.
  • Acts 7:29 NASB – 29 “At this remark, MOSES FLED AND BECAME AN ALIEN IN THE LAND OF MIDIAN, where he became the father of two sons.
  • Hebrews 11:9 NASB – 9 By faith he lived as an alien in the land of promise, as in a foreign [land,] dwelling in tents with Isaac and Jacob, fellow heirs of the same promise;

And as the household of faith we are to consider ourselves:

  • 1 Peter 1:1 NASB – 1 Peter, an apostle of Jesus Christ, To those who reside as aliens, scattered throughout Pontus, Galatia, Cappadocia, Asia, and Bithynia, who are chosen
  • 1 Peter 2:11 NASB – 11 Beloved, I urge you as aliens and strangers to abstain from fleshly lusts which wage war against the soul.

Therefore God wants us to welcome the alien into our midst:

  • Mark 16:15 NASB – 15 And He said to them, “Go into all the world and preach the gospel to all creation.
  • Zechariah 8:22 ESV – 22 Many peoples and strong nations shall come to seek the LORD of hosts in Jerusalem and to entreat the favor of the LORD.
  • Revelation 15:4 ESV – 4 Who will not fear, O Lord, and glorify your name? For you alone are holy. All nations will come and worship you, for your righteous acts have been revealed.”

The unspoken theology of the modern church in America is that the alien is to be feared. Yet the number one command of scripture is to “Fear not.” The reality is either we are praying “Here I am Lord send me” or God will bring the foreigner to us. The real stranger danger is that we will be a danger to the stranger. Are there those who would want to due us harm out of envy, of course. But as our own struggle against racism has shown, one does not have to be a foreigner to be a danger to our safety and well being. History has shown that the overwhelming majority who have come to the United States do so to escape tyranny, not to bring it.

President Regan did not see a wall was needed to make America Great Again, instead, quite the opposite:

“Through this Golden Door has come millions of men and women. These families came here to work. Others came to America and often harrowing conditions. They didn’t ask what this country could do for them but what they could do to make this refuge the greatest home of freedom in history. They brought with them courage and the values of family, work, and freedom. Let us pledge to each other that we can make America great again.”

But instead of trying so hard as Christians in the United states trying to make the United States Great Again, instead how about we work to make God’s Name known amongst the nations as Great Again!

  • Psalm 2:8 NASB – 8 ‘Ask of Me, and I will surely give the nations as Your inheritance, And the [very] ends of the earth as Your possession.

Because all the earth is the Lord’s not just those who reside in the United States.

  • Exodus 19:5-6 NASB – 5 ‘Now then, if you will indeed obey My voice and keep My covenant, then you shall be My own possession among all the peoples, for all the earth is Mine; 6 and you shall be to Me a kingdom of priests and a holy nation.’ These are the words that you shall speak to the sons of Israel.”
